Understanding Root Canal Therapy

A root canal treatment, also known as endodontic therapy, is a dental procedure designed to save a tooth that is badly decayed or infected. Deep within the tooth lies the pulp, a soft tissue containing nerves and blood vessels. When this pulp becomes inflamed or infected due to deep decay, repeated dental procedures, or a crack or chip in the tooth, it can lead to significant pain and necessitate a root canal. The primary goal of this treatment is to remove the damaged pulp, thoroughly clean and disinfect the inside of the tooth, and then fill and seal it.

The Root Canal Procedure Explained

Local endodontists and general dentists in Chinatown, California, typically perform root canal treatments with precision and care. The process generally involves several key steps:

  • Diagnosis and Imaging: The dental professional will first examine the tooth and take X-rays to assess the extent of the damage and the shape of the root canals.
  • Anesthesia: Local anesthetic is administered to numb the tooth and surrounding gum tissue, ensuring the patient’s comfort throughout the procedure.
  • Isolation: A dental dam, a small sheet of rubber, is placed around the tooth to keep it dry and clean during treatment.
  • Access Opening: The dentist makes a small opening in the crown of the tooth to access the pulp chamber and root canals.
  • Cleaning and Shaping: Using specialized tiny instruments, the dentist carefully removes the inflamed or infected pulp. The canals are then cleaned, enlarged, and shaped to prepare them for filling.
  • Disinfection: The inside of the canals is thoroughly disinfected to eliminate any remaining bacteria.
  • Filling the Canals: Once cleaned and dried, the root canals are filled with a biocompatible material, usually a rubber-like substance called gutta-percha, and sealed with adhesive cement.
  • Restoration: A temporary filling is placed in the crown opening. In subsequent visits, the tooth will likely require a permanent restoration, such as a crown, to protect it from further damage and restore its full function.

The materials commonly used include local anesthetics, dental dams made of latex or non-latex materials, various dental instruments for cleaning (files of different sizes), disinfectants, gutta-percha for filling, and dental cements. Key Benefits of Root Canal Therapy

Opting for a root canal treatment offers several significant advantages, particularly for the diverse community in Chinatown and surrounding San Francisco neighborhoods.

  • Saving Natural Teeth: The most crucial benefit is preserving your natural tooth, which is essential for proper chewing, speech, and maintaining the alignment of adjacent teeth.
  • Pain Relief: Root canal therapy effectively eliminates the severe pain caused by infected pulp, providing immediate relief.
  • Preventing Further Infection: By removing the infected pulp, the procedure prevents the spread of infection to other parts of the mouth and body.
  • Restored Functionality: Once restored with a crown, the treated tooth functions like a natural tooth, allowing you to eat and speak comfortably.
  • Aesthetic Preservation: With modern restorative techniques, a treated tooth can look and feel completely natural, maintaining the aesthetic harmony of your smile.

How long does a typical root canal appointment take in Chinatown?

The duration of a root canal appointment can vary depending on the complexity of the case and the specific tooth involved. However, most root canal treatments can be completed within one to two hours per visit. For simpler cases, it might be finished in a single session, while more complex procedures or teeth with multiple canals may require a second visit for the final restoration.

What are the facility types for root canal services in Chinatown, California?

In Chinatown and the surrounding San Francisco areas, you will find root canal services offered in a variety of settings. These include general dental practices where dentists are trained and equipped to perform root canals, as well as specialized endodontic clinics. Specialized endodontic clinics are staffed by endodontists, dentists who have completed additional years of training and focus exclusively on root canal therapy and other procedures involving the tooth’s pulp. Both types of facilities are committed to providing high-quality care.

Is a root canal necessarily painful?

Modern root canal techniques and anesthesia have made the procedure significantly less painful than it was in the past. Before starting, dentists administer local anesthetic to numb the area completely, ensuring you feel little to no pain during the treatment. You may experience some sensitivity or mild discomfort for a few days after the procedure as the surrounding tissues heal, but this is typically manageable with over-the-counter pain relievers.
